STRETCH AND FOLD
With sourdough, the gluten doesn’t need developing by kneading. Trust me, you will get a better rise and lighter loaf by using the long, slow fermentation to align the gluten molecules instead of kneading. Just leaving the dough to ferment, with a few simple stretches and folds to help, will result in a gluten structure that gives the bread the complex network of sticky strands that capture the CO2 as the yeasts get to work consuming the sugars in the flour.
⠀⠀⠀⠀⠀⠀⠀⠀⠀
Gentler is better. Do more early on. In fact, less is sometimes better, depending on the flour...
